Frequently Asked Questions about Indian Creek
How much are Studio apartments in Indian Creek?
There are currently 524 Studio Apartments in Indian Creek with rent ranges from $1,200 to $4,848 with an average price of $2,113.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Indian Creek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Indian Creek ranges from $1,300 to $8,823 with an average monthly rent of $2,323.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Indian Creek c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Indian Creek range from $1,825 to $20,576.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,627.
How expensive are Indian Creek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 99 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Indian Creek on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,300 to $13,212 - averaging $5,670 for the location.
